A source of light is placed in front of a screen. Intensity of light on the screen is I. Two Polaroids P1 and P2 are so placed in between the source of light and screen that the intensity of light on screen is I/2. P2 should be rotated by an angle of (degrees) so that the intensity of light on the screen becomes 3I8{{3I} \over 8}83I​.

Correct answer: 30

  1. Initial setup

Let the intensity of unpolarized light from the source reaching the screen without Polaroids be I.I.I.

Two Polaroids P1P_1P1​ and P2P_2P2​ are inserted, and the final intensity is given as I2.\frac{I}{2}.2I​.

  1. Use Malus' law

When unpolarized light passes through the first Polaroid, its intensity becomes half: I1=I2.I_1 = \frac{I}{2}.I1​=2I​.

If the angle between the transmission axes of P1P_1P1​ and P2P_2P2​ is θ\thetaθ, then after passing through P2P_2P2​: I2=I1cos⁡2θ=I2cos⁡2θ.I_2 = I_1 \cos^2\theta = \frac{I}{2}\cos^2\theta.I2​=I1​cos2θ=2I​cos2θ.

Given that this equals I2\frac{I}{2}2I​: I2cos⁡2θ=I2.\frac{I}{2}\cos^2\theta = \frac{I}{2}.2I​cos2θ=2I​.

So, cos⁡2θ=1  ⟹  θ=0∘.\cos^2\theta = 1 \implies \theta = 0^\circ.cos2θ=1⟹θ=0∘.

Thus initially the two Polaroids are parallel.

  1. After rotating P2P_2P2​

Now let P2P_2P2​ be rotated by an angle ϕ\phiϕ. Then the angle between the axes becomes ϕ\phiϕ, and the final intensity is I′=I2cos⁡2ϕ.I' = \frac{I}{2}\cos^2\phi.I′=2I​cos2ϕ.

We want I′=3I8.I' = \frac{3I}{8}.I′=83I​.

Therefore, I2cos⁡2ϕ=3I8.\frac{I}{2}\cos^2\phi = \frac{3I}{8}.2I​cos2ϕ=83I​.

Cancel III: 12cos⁡2ϕ=38.\frac{1}{2}\cos^2\phi = \frac{3}{8}.21​cos2ϕ=83​.

So, cos⁡2ϕ=34.\cos^2\phi = \frac{3}{4}.cos2ϕ=43​.

Hence, cos⁡ϕ=32.\cos\phi = \frac{\sqrt{3}}{2}.cosϕ=23​​.

Thus, ϕ=30∘.\phi = 30^\circ.ϕ=30∘.

  1. Final answer

The required rotation is 30.\boxed{30}.30​.
